A vintage 8mm home movie from 1968 captures a man and woman learning to dance in the front room of a Toledo, Ohio home. The grainy, nostalgic footage shows their feet moving rhythmically across the floor, with a towel and shoes visible nearby. Shot on 8mm film, this authentic slice of Americana reflects mid-1960s domestic life and social customs.
